TL Foundation Supports Connect's 2026 Cool Companies to Strengthen San Diego's Innovation Economy
S For Story/10688181
Philanthropic venture fund supports next generation of startups to expand opportunity and economic growth for future generations
SAN DIEGO - s4story -- At a time when access to capital remains challenging for many startups, the TL Foundation is supporting Connect's 2026 Cool Companies program to help ensure San Diego's most promising founders have the opportunity to grow and succeed.
Connect's newest class of 24 San Diego startups were selected for Cool Companies, the organization's annual capital program spotlighting venture-ready technology and life sciences companies preparing to raise institutional funding.
Through its role as a sponsor, the TL Foundation is helping expand access to capital while advancing its mission to build a stronger, more inclusive innovation economy for future generations.
"Connect does a great job of elevating promising startups. It's helpful as we look to invest," said Andy Ballester, chairman of the TL Foundation. "In today's environment, connecting the right founders with the right capital is more important than ever to keep our San Diego innovation economy competitive."

The TL Foundation is a San Diego-based 501(c)(3) nonprofit philanthropic venture fund that invests in early-stage technology and life sciences companies and works alongside founders to help them grow. By reinvesting 100 percent of returns back into the community, the TL Foundation creates an evergreen source of capital designed to fuel innovation and strengthen the region's economic future over time.
Supporting programs like Cool Companies reflects the TL Foundation's broader commitment to building a thriving innovation ecosystem. While strong innovation economies define world-class cities, few philanthropic models are structured to scale economic impact. The TL Foundation aims to help close that gap by turning startup success into long-term community benefit.
The TL Foundation has previously invested $400,000 in Cool Companies alumni, including Condor Software, Looq, Papillon Therapeutics and Resolute Science (https://resolutescience.com/), underscoring the program's role as a pipeline for high-quality, investment-ready startups.
